As noted in the comment in the spec file, the web site didn't provide a
direct-download link for the voices -- it all went through a script. So
there was no canonical URL. At my request, the upstream people fixed this
for future releases of the voices, which are included in my in-progress
(haven't worked on it in a while, though) next update to the package, which
you can find info about at
<https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=235051>.
